The cheapest way to get from Quito to Split is to car and fly which costs €470 - €1800 and takes 18h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Quito to Split is to car and fly which takes 18h 40m and costs €470 - €1800.
The distance between Quito and Split is 10457 km.
It takes approximately 18h 40m to get from Quito to Split, including transfers.
Split is 7h ahead of Quito. It is currently 11:38 PM in Quito and 6:38 AM in Split.

There is no direct connection from Quito to Split. However, you can drive to Quito Airport, walk to Mariscal Sucre International Airport (UIO) airport, fly to Split Airport (SPU), walk to Split Airport, then take the shuttle to Split Bus Station. Alternatively, you can drive to Quito Airport, walk to Mariscal Sucre International Airport (UIO) airport, fly to Dubrovnik Airport (DBV), walk to Dubrovnik Airport, take the bus to Dubrovnik, Autobusni kolodvor, take the line 10 bus to Placa Gruz, walk to Dubrovnik, then take the shuttle to Split.
